Chapter History: 2005-06

Below is a summary of your chapter's activities for 2005/06.  Sadly, the one activity for this year was retiring the chapter.  This page summarizes the status of the chapter at this end point in its history.

Awards

Cash gifts of $500 were given to schools in our region which had participated in chapter activities during the past several years.   The Chapter did this as one of its last acts in support of materials science, engineering, and technology education in our region.  Our hope was that the awards would be used to support student activities and promote academic achievement in areas related to materials.  This gift was also our way to thank these schools for their past participation in our activities and to, in some small way, to make up for not being here to offer our student awards programs.

The recipients (school, department, and instructor) are listed below:

bulletCity College of San Francisco, Engineering and Technology, Wendy Kaufmyn
bulletDiablo Valley College, Mechanical Technology, Dave Johnson
bulletLos Medanos College, Welding Technology, Andy Ochoa
bulletMarin College, Engineering, Erik Dunmire
bulletSierra College, Engineering, Debbie Hill
bulletSolano College, Mathematics and Science, Melanie Lutz
bulletU. N. Reno, Materials Science and Engineering, Olivia Graeve
bulletU. C. Berkeley, Department of Materials and Mining Engineering, Dan Sanchez - chair of the student chapter
bulletU. C. Davis, Chemical Engineering and Materials Science, Elliot Szkup - chair of the student chapter
bulletYuba College, Engineering, Steve Klein
